  • Applications

    2-(4-Methoxyphenyl)butane (CAS 4917-90-2) is commonly used as a chemical intermediate in the fragrance and flavor industries, serving as a scaffold for synthesizing anisyl-containing aroma compounds and related arylbutane derivatives. In perfumery and cosmetics, it may function as a building block for fragrance ingredients or be evaluated as a precursor in developing odor-active compounds. It may also find use in industrial manufacturing as a specialty intermediate for subsequent chemical transformations that yield odorant-related components in coatings or inks. Additionally, it can be used in research and development as a synthetic intermediate in organic synthesis workflows, subject to local regulations and formulation limits.
